Built as a novel concept to ‘democratise’ e-commerce in India, ONDC has seen limited success in specific pockets. But it’s still an emerging player in a highly competitive market.
Food delivery and e-commerce are two sectors where the government has created an indirect mechanism to stop the duopoly system, without clipping the wings of the giants.
Indian government-backed non-profit digital commerce initiative, ONDC offers an open source network for all to exchange goods and services and is independent of any specific platform.
